FAQs About Denaturalization

  • What Is Denaturalization?
    Denaturalization is the legal process through which a person's citizenship is revoked by the government.
  • On What Grounds Can Denaturalization Occur?
    Denaturalization can occur if an individual is found to have obtained citizenship through fraud, misrepresentation, or concealment of material facts.
  • What Are the Consequences of Denaturalization?
